Zusammenfassung: | summary: the typical structure of interlocking directorates among financial and industrial corporations in today's economy is characterized by the central position of the banks and those corporations with the highest turnover rate. there exist two competing approaches that aim at explaining that structure: the theory of environmental control and the theory of financial control. based on data on personal interlocks among 70 austrian industrial corporations and 9 austrian banks, the present paperexamines which of the two approaches can more adequately explain the typical structure of the industrial and financial interlocks. for testing the data we employ a graph theory model which makes the potential intercorporate flow of power operationalby the direction of the interlocks. the results of our analysis support the presumptions of the theory of financial control.; |
